Mary Bye Obituary

Mary Jane Bye, 81 BELVIDERE - Mary Jane Bye, 81, of Belvidere died Friday, May 13, 2011, in Northwoods Care Center after a short illness. Mary was born April 17, 1930, to Addison and Hazel (Artz) Buse Sr. She married Merrill J. Bye on Aug, 7, 1949, in Belvidere. Mary worked for National Sewing Machine before her marriage and was a fantastic caregiver to her family. She was a member of the Boone County Fire Protection District 2 women's auxiliary. She loved to tend her flower gardens and bird watch. She was loved and will be missed by her son, Dale Bye; son in-law, Dennis Peaslee; granddaughter, Dawn (Erik) Lutzow; great-granddaughter, Madison Lutzow; special friend, Darlene Carlson; and nieces and nephews. Mary is predeceased by her parents; husband; daughter, Judy Peaslee; sister, Ida Fisk; brothers, Addison and James Buse. Service at 11:30 a.m. Tuesday, May 17, in Buck-Wheeler-Hyland Funeral Home, 218 W. Hurlbut Ave., with the Rev. Allan Buss, pastor of Immanuel Lutheran Church, officiating. Visitation from 5 to 8 p.m. Monday, May 16, in the funeral home. Burial in Shattuck Grove Cemetery. Memorials can be given in care of the Boone County Fire Protection District 2 in Mary's memory.
